Output 9905105339464a3a5688640c9a08c738cf052649aa41e4c9c62d23de93932ee4:3

value
22578
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bafa23d985886df2026f6fbc060d74dcf86a4469a761367d55d44c7d104da4d3
address
bc1phtaz8kv93pklyqn0d77qvrt5mnux53rf5asnvl2463x86yzd5nfslzhhpj
transaction
9905105339464a3a5688640c9a08c738cf052649aa41e4c9c62d23de93932ee4